Mariano Quiros (IFAE Barcelona)

Baryogenesis and inflaton hunting at the LHC

The Higgs potential can be destabilized during (high scale) inflation by fluctuations in the de Sitter space. We propose a simple model where the inflaton, non-minimally coupled to gravity, is coupled to the Higgs field, changing the quartic coupling beta function such that the Higgs potential is stabilized. This leads to a modified Higgs Inflation scenario where the Higgs participates in the inflationary process. If the inflaton is coupled to the Chern-Simons density of the hypercharge, it can generate baryon asymmetry at the electroweak phase transition. Naturalness arguments require the inflaton to be at the TeV scale. If the inflaton has a TeV mass, it can be produced at the LHC, mainly by gluon-gluon fusion.
